Learn the basics of auto layout including resolving layout conflicts in part 2 of this auto layout tutorial, fully up-to-date with iOS 9.
Learn the basics of auto layout in part 1 of this auto layout tutorial, fully up-to-date for iOS 9.
Review what you learned in our Intro to Auto Layout video tutorial and get some tips and resources to help you learn more about mastering layouts.
Learn how the layout system works, how to animate changes to constraints, and which other animation methods you should or should not use with Auto Layout.
Learn about debugging in Auto Layout.
Learn how to use the visual format language to create multiple constraints in a much more compact way.
Learn about some great tools for working with Auto Layout in code: UILayoutGuide and NSLayoutAnchor.
Learn how to create constraints in code.
Learn about the automatic constraints that some views create based on their intrinsic content size.
Learn about constraint priorities, the problems they solve, and the power they bring to your layout.
Learn about editing constraints in Auto Layout.
Learn about different ways you can use control drag to create constraints and how to use container views to apply constraints to a group of views.
Learn how to create a layout and the corresponding constraints using Auto Layout in Interface Builder.
Find out why you should use Auto Layout and what’s covered in our Intro to Auto Layout video tutorial series.
In this video tutorial you’ll learn about the Cartography Auto Layout Library, which makes your syntax quick and very readable from a distance.